Lori,
That's tough that you did not get a great response for donations. I imagine you have already thought of this, but given that you are down to the wire I would suggest you start calling local places that you have perhaps already mailed letters to or emailed and have not heard back from. We had a lot of places with no response. Contacted them at least two months ago and did not hear back. I called some of them and got a few donations right there and then on the spot. They were like "sure, we'd love to donate an item!". They never mentioned that we had previously contacted them. They may have been busy and tossed the letter aside or filed an email ect and never looked at it again. Again, these are local places that this happened with and were smaller businesses. Also, hopefully you can be creative and come up with ideas that don't require an actual donation. Like some of the things that have been mentioned here. The front row seats to school shows or graduation ect...Maybe give a quick call to a local radio or television station and ask if they can donate a private tour? And of course there is that last minute shout out and plea to parents and teachers to donate an item!

Norcal -

Disney leaves a bit of leeway. Last year our event was end of April, this year it is 4/21. If they had been strict on the year, we were about a week shy, so it's probably once per calendar year. Most of the other "once in a year" companies do the same and we haven't been turned down for that reason yet this year.
